From June 1948 to May 1949, the citizens of West Berlin were supplied by an airlift. What was the reason for this?

Correct answer

The Soviet Union interrupted all land transportation.

Why is this answer correct?

From June 1948 the Soviet Union blockaded all land and water routes into West Berlin to force the Western powers out of the city. They responded with the airlift: for almost a year, "raisin bombers" supplied two million people from the air.

This question is reproduced unchanged from the official question catalogue of the German Federal Office for Migration and Refugees (BAMF). The real Einbürgerungstest draws 33 questions from this set; 17 correct answers are needed to pass.
